My town is an old mill town with an anomalous women’s college, reborn as a yuppie/new age haven. There used to be big, imposing, graceful banks, as well as a hardware store and a grocery store on Main St. Now the banks have become galleries, and the old Five and Dime has been transformed into housewares, Tintin comics and french table linens. The hardware and grocery stores got moved out to the strip which fortunately isn’t too far because the town is still relatively small.

This used to be a bank, and is now the biggest gallery in town. The sphinx resides on top of the old night deposit box, well bolted down. Many people touch his nose as they go by, for luck or habit or something.
